RIFLE SHOOTING
MASTERTON-OPAKI CLUB. TEAM TO MEET TARARUA. The following team has been selected to represent the Masterton-Opaki Club in a match against the Tararua Rifle Club on Saturday for the InterClub Shield: H. K. Smith, D. P. Donald, J. W. Curtin, H. H. Mawley, E. M, Wrigley, H. King, V. E. Donald, R. J. King, D. S. McKenzie, W. H. Kummer. Emergencies: W. Dornan, B. R. Jenkins, R. V. Mason. Any unable to be present should notify Mr R. J. King or the secretary immediately. On April 19, the Petone Rifle Club will visit the local club to compete in a team’s match. All Opaki members can participate in this and it is hoped that a very strong muster will be present. A competition will take place in conjunction with this match for all members not included in the team chosen against Tararua Rifle Club, commencing at 10 a.m. The second field day and final stage of the club championship will be held on April 2G, commencing at 8 a.m. sharp.
